Bureau County Sports Hall of Fame: Howard brothers a fixture in Princeton Tiger sports in the 1960s

Bureau County Sports Hall of Fame: Howard brothers a fixture in Princeton Tiger sports in the 1960s

The Howard name was a fixture in athletics at Princeton High School in the 1960s. Bill was the first to suit up for the Tigers, graduating in 1960, followed by Bob (1962), Corby (1964), Tim (1968) and Jim (1970), setting records in track and competing in football, basketball.

From growing up in Bureau County to winning a NBA ring, Matt Tumbleson shares his life experiences

From growing up in Bureau County to winning a NBA ring, Matt Tumbleson shares his life experiences

Matt Tumbleson always wanted to work for the Chicago Bulls growing up in Buda. He's made a 21-year career in the NBA, including the past 14 years with the Oklahoma City Thunder. He chatted with Kevin Hieronymus about how he's chased and made that dream come true.
